eCatalogues: the transition continues

As the economics of rare book catalogues continues to decline many dealers have shifted from printed paper to electronic eCatalogues.  Here is a snapshot of the most recent fifty catalogues we have received.  They all deserve support.

 

In the trade the time-honored process of issuing printed catalogues has lost some of its appeal as the web has created new ways to reach buyers while undermining other aspects of the selling process.  In this transition period eCatalogues are finding a place in the selling mix.
